Tee Higgins Ready to Go on Sunday Against Cleveland

Saturday, September 6, 11:40 AM

Cincinnati Bengals wide receiver Tee Higgins spent all last season looking for a new contract. He also missed time due to injury. However, the wideout was productive when healthy and finished the year with 911 yards and 10 touchdowns off 73 catches (12 games). Equipped with a new four-year contract, Higgins should be ready to produce when the Bengals meet the Browns in Week 1. He scored in each of his two encounters with Cleveland during the 2024 campaign. With this expected to be one of the highest-scoring games of the week, Higgins has a chance of exceeding expectations for fantasy managers. He's a must-start on Sunday, although most know that already.

Bijan Robinson Excellent as Receiver

Sunday, September 7, 6:31 PM

Atlanta Falcons running back Bijan Robinson was stuffed on the ground, but still had a strong performance against the Tampa Bay Buccaneers on Sunday. Robinson got off to a great start with a 50-yard receiving touchdown on the opening drive. The Falcons continued to throw the ball his way as Robinson couldn't get anything going on the ground. He rushed 12 times for 24 yards in the Week 1 loss. However, Robinson salvaged his fantasy value by hauling in six of his seven targets for 100 yards through the air with one touchdown. He'll hope to have more success on the ground during the Week 2 matchup against the Minnesota Vikings.
